The Rand-Bryan House

As a kid growing up in Garner, NC we often drove by the Christmas tree farm that sits on a hill overlooking highway 50.  There is a beautiful old house that sits up on the hill as well and I always thought it would be so cool to live there and play in the fields of trees.  They have turned the house and grounds into an amazing event, wedding and reception venue called The Rand-Bryan House. I recently had the opportunity to work on some portfolio bridal shots in the house and on the grounds.  A big thanks to my lovely wife Jatana for master minding the whole thing (I just took pictures),  Samantha, Alex, and Shelia (modeling and makeup) and Carolina Bridal World in Smithfield for the awesome dress and veil.  And a big thanks to Martha and The Rand-Bryan House for the opportunity to shoot at a great venue in my home town.
